[MYBROADBAND]() This Week In Tech Top Stories [Slow Internet speeds in South Africa — break in undersea cables]( South African Internet users are complaining about online services performing poorly, including Akamai-hosted Disney+. [How to lose your driver’s licence under South Africa’s new traffic fine laws]( The incoming Administrative Adjudication of Road Traffic Offences (Aarto) Act features a demerit point system that will be rolled out nationally after South Africa's apex court declared it constitutional. [Eskom milked dry]( Middlemen got very rich at Eskom’s expense, former CEO André de Ruyter has revealed. [Three South African financial tech companies ranked among the world’s best]( Three South African fintechs have been ranked among the world's best — alongside the likes of Robin Hood, Tencent, Stripe, PayPal, and SoFi. [Legal challenge against South Africa's 5-year driver's licence cards]( Afriforum contends that limiting the validity of the driver's licence card is in conflict with the National Road Traffic Act and that the transport minister's unrestricted powers in deciding on the validity period are unconstitutional and invalid. [Eskom manager allegedly targeted by hitman told André de Ruyter of corruption — and got arrested]( Dorothy Mmushi said she had reported her findings to De Ruyter, who then went on national television and took credit for her work. [Koeberg Unit 1 “will” be back online five months late — Eskom]( The steam generator replacement on unit one was scheduled to be finished in early June, but unanticipated logistical obstacles along with issues integrating a local workforce slowed the timeline, said Eskom chief nuclear officer Keith Featherstone. [Eskom accused of colluding with municipality to block solar power plants]( The Democratic Alliance says Eskom and Mafube municipality are colluding to block Frankfort residents from using their own solar power plant. Flesch reading score

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
